Trust Account at Marin County Juvenile Hall

A trust account gets created when an inmate is booked in Marin County Juvenile Hall, enabling inmates to buy items and to pay various medical services and jail fees. Depositors sending cash and items must include the jail number with their details (name and address). If this information is missing on the deposited items, the facility will return the items to the depositor. Funds can be added through three modes to the inmate's account. Commissary Items and Online Fees

Inmates are allowed to buy commissary items such as hygiene items and snacks during their incarceration. Money spent will be deducted from their account. Pricing for these items may vary depending on the department of correction rules. Families and friends can deposit money in their inmate's account, but first, they need to create an account through the Marin County Juvenile Hall website to deposit money on the inmate's behalf. Money will be credited to the inmate's account once the transaction is complete. Marin County Juvenile Hall might charge an online fee for the deposit. Contact the facility for more information on their online fees and the amount. Please note: deposits cannot be sent over the phone by contacting Marin County Juvenile Hall.
